Yes, but if you don't turn the pressure down, you will take the undercarriage paint off.

You have to be VERY aware of what you're pointing the nozzle at, and where the seams are, and what can be damaged by the cutting action these things produce. A lot of diy weekend type guys just are not aware enough or have enough experience to appreciate what the prudent limits are.
